Question: The reasons document explains why each item of information does or does not raise a substantial new question of patentability (or SNQ) in a supplemental examination. What should a reasons document include? Answer: The reasons document explains why each item of information does or does not raise a SNQ. The reasons document should include: A statement that the item of information raises a SNQ and identify the claims for which the SNQ is raised; Where appropriate, a statement that the item of information does not raise a SNQ and identify the claims for which a SNQ is not raised;…
